The blk_register_buf() API is an optimization hint that allows some block drivers to avoid I/O buffer housekeeping or bounce buffers.
Add an -r option to register the I/O buffer so that qemu-io can be used to test the blk_register_buf() API. The next commit will add a test that uses the new option.
